#fe4bc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e4bc4 is composed of 99.6% red, 29.4%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 22.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 319.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 64.5%. #fe4bc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#fd0089.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#fe4bc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e4bc4 has RGB values of R:254, G:75,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.23, K:0. Its decimal value is 16665540.

Shades and Tints of #fe4bc4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f000a is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e4bc4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aa9fa7 is the less saturated color, while #fe4bc4 is the most saturated one.
